A PAIR OF ELIZABETH II SILVER NOVELTY PEPPER AND MUSTARD POTS

by Richard Comyns, London 1971 and 1976, each modelled as a frog in a seated pose, with textured decoration and glass eyes, the mustard pot with a hinged mouth and matching gilt spoon forming a tongue. (2) 5.2cm high, 8 troy ounces gross



The marks are clear. The spoon is original. In generally very good condition.
